quote:

adoption fees are fricking sinful.



Not if you adopt through the state. We finalize our son's adoption soon and we haven't had to pay a dime for legal fees, healthcare, or daycare. Our only out of pocket costs are for the basic care of our son, which is mostly offset by our monthly foster stipend.

If you go private, then yes be prepared to shell out some serious dough.

I think you should update the title OP, lots of people are reading the original story without reading the update and posting based on that.

ETA: Cliff Notes:

-Mom is hospitalized, asks random chick to watch her son.
-Random chick is tasked with dropping son off at his dad’s house
-Random chick goes to wrong house (next door neighbor), knocks on the door. No answer, so random chick just leaves son on door step.
-Neighbors take child and call the authorities.
-Dad assumes “plans have changed”, so he leaves the house not knowing his son is with neighbors.

Lots of fail all around.
